asked 04/04/15Is the following question clearly and completely worded?
50.0 mL of 0.100 M HCl was added to a buffer consisting of 0.025 moles of sodium acetate and 0.030 moles of acetic acid. What is the pH of the buffer after the addition of the acid? Ka of acetic acid is 1.7 x 10-5. Their answer is 4.53. It has been about 12 years since I've done a problem like this.
